Irena is data manipulations and analysis toolbox for smallangle scattering saxs, sans, usaxs, usans data. It is free by request upon purchase of an rpudplus license. A power law distribution is fitted with maximum likelyhood methods as recommended by newman and by default the bfgs optimization see mle algorithm is applied the additional arguments are passed to the mle function, so it is possible to. I tried using the package powerlaw to plot a few powerlaw fits. This argument makes it possible to fit only the tail of the distribution. Added buttons to perform power law fit and background fit. Levchenko and romain ranciere1 authorized for distribution by atish ghosh april 2010 abstract this working paper should not be reported as representing the views of the imf. A power law distribution is fitted with maximum likelyhood methods as recommended by newman and by default the bfgs optimization see mle algorithm is applied the additional arguments are passed to the mle function, so it is possible to change the optimization method andor its parameters. Additionally, a goodnessof fit based approach is used to estimate the lower cutoff for the scaling region. But i could not plot multiple plots on the same graph.
An implementation of maximum likelihood estimators for a variety of heavy tailed distributions, including both the discrete and continuous power law distributions. A python package for analysis of heavytailed distributions. Acoustic attenuation follows frequency power laws within wide frequency bands for many complex media. Many useful r function come in packages, free libraries of code written by r s active user community. The wgcna r software package is a comprehensive collection of r functions for performing various aspects of weighted correlation network analysis. In this document i just want to show how to plot the data which following power law distribution. This page hosts implementations of the methods we describe in the article, including several by authors other than us. For other relationships we can try fitting a curve.
However, i can only pass one group of numbers to do the evaluation. As you can see in the reproducible example below, one of the outputs of this function is the loglikelihood loglik of the fitted parameters question. The example provided in this package is word frequency. The powerlaw package implements 3 other alternatives that you can compare.
If you are using rstudio server, you will be prompted to download the powerpoint presentation file. Few empirical distributions fit a power law for all their values, but rather follow a power law in the tail. We cant use all the packages in the power bi site because it includes the packages which can be used for r custom visuals development. Transforming data is one step in addressing data that do not fit model assumptions, and is also used to coerce different variables to have similar distributions. Create visuals by using r packages in the power bi service. The closer r2 is to 1, the closer the data is to the best fit curve in general. When you knit an r markdown document, rstudio renders your document in the powerpoint output format.
It is mostly useable for analysis of data in materials science, chemistry, polymers, metallurgy, physics, and other systems of typically solid or liquid samples. Because ggplot2 isnt part of the standard distribution of r, you have to download the package from cran and install it. The r project for statistical computing getting started. The number called r on the graph describes how close the curve fits the data. Specificationhow to check if the asus wireless router supports 2. The powerlaw package supports a number of distributions. Downloads manuals, drivers, firmware, and software, declaration of conformity. The data to fit, a numeric vector containing integer values. This page is a companion for the paper on power law distributions in binned empirical data, written by yogesh virkar and aaron clauset me.
A principal improvement is the use of glmnet friedman, hastie, and tibshirani 2008 to perform rule fitting. The package includes functions for network construction, module detection, gene selection, calculations of topological properties, data simulation, visualization, and interfacing with external software. This section contains the r reference documentation for proprietary packages from microsoft used for data science and machine learning on premises and at scale. Additionally, a goodnessof fit based approach is used. You can use the powerful r programming language to create visuals in the power bi service. There can be other distributions that can be just as good or even a better fit. No installation, no downloads, no accounts, no payments. Aug 08, 2017 kolmogorovsmirnov is a goodness of fit test. If you are using rstudio desktop, your powerpoint presentation will automatically open and take you back to the last slide you were viewing. It builds on and extends many of the optimization methods of scipy. The graph of our data appears to have one bend, so lets try fitting a quadratic linear model using stat fitted line plot while the rsquared is high, the fitted line plot shows that the regression line systematically over and underpredicts the data at different points in the curve. I will use the dataset from this question on stack overflow. Nonlinear leastsquares minimization and curvefitting for python lmfit provides a highlevel interface to nonlinear optimization and curve fitting problems for python.
Even though our first data point is y 0 at t 0, the best fit curve does not equal 0 at t 2 0. This package contains r functions for fitting, comparing and visualising heavy tailed distributions. Nonlinear leastsquares minimization and curvefitting for. Dec 07, 2018 you can compare a power law to this distribution in the normal way shown above r, p results. Choose if you want an ordinary power of attorney or durable power of attorney. Create, print, and download your free power of attorney using our stepbystep process.
Curve fitting is the process of constructing a curve, or mathematical function, that has the best fit to a series of data points, possibly subject to constraints. How to install, load, and unload packages in r dummies. Nov 11, 2016 finally, power package can be very effective as an indoor training aid since you dont need to make fullspeed swings to work on your positions. Nonlinear leastsquares minimization and curvefitting. Use fitoptions to display available property names and default values for the specific library mod. General power of attorney form free download on upcounsel. I believe both of them are dedicated to modeling the distribution of one categorical variable, but neither. In order to greatly decrease the barriers to using good statistical methods for fitting power law distributions, we developed the powerlaw python package.
In short, one can add images, tables and text into documents from r. The following sections provide an alphabetical table of which r packages are supported in power bi, and which are not. Im aware of clauset et als work and the powerlaw package in r. R function library reference machine learning server. R is a free software environment for statistical computing and graphics. To download r, please choose your preferred cran mirror. Club too far across the line or laid off at the top of the backswing. Computation of power and level tables for hypothesis tests.
Aug 14, 2012 i would like to calculate the coefficient for a trendline power law from data. For example, if you are usually working with data frames, probably you will have heard about dplyr or data. R offers daily email updates about r news and tutorials about learning r and many other topics. The choice of probit versus logit depends largely on individual preferences. It compiles and runs on a wide variety of unix platforms, windows and macos. Accordingly, at my specific request and insistence, i have named and appointed. Pick one thats close to your location, and r will connect to that server to download the package files. This page hosts our implementations of the methods we describe. May 09, 20 for linear relationships we can perform a simple linear regression. Allometric scaling laws for relationships between biological variables are among the best known powerlaw functions in nature.
Overall, it provides a principled approach to fitting power laws to data. Alternative distributions just because we came to the conclusion that the power law distribution is a good fit to the data of family names, it does not mean that the power law is the best fit. Gillespie newcastle university 15th july 2014 over the last few years, the power law distribution has been used as the data generating mechanism in many disparate elds. Part of the reason r has become so popular is the vast array of packages available at the cran and bioconductor repositories. Specificationhow to check if the asus wireless router supports 3g4g usb adapter.
Learn which r packages are supported power bi microsoft docs. The comprehensive r archive network cran is a network of servers around the world that contain the source code, documentation, and addon packages for r. Beta version 70712 rulefit tm implements the learning method and interpretational tools described in predictive learning via rule ensembles rulefit3 tm is a newer version with improved analytics and some additional options. They increase the power of r by improving existing base r functionalities, or by adding new ones. For more information about r in power bi, see the r visuals article. Snippets lets you run any r code through your browser. It presents a version of the power law tools from here that work with data that are binned. Additionally, a goodnessoffit based approach is used to estimate the lower cutoff for the scaling region. May 01, 20 in recent years effective statistical methods for fitting power laws have been developed, but appropriate use of these techniques requires significant programming and statistical insight.
This package implements both the discrete and continuous maximum likelihood estimators for fitting the powerlaw distribution to data. This software package provides easy commands for basic fitting and statistical analysis of distributions. Probit analysis will produce results similar logistic regression. Irena package for analysis of smallangle scattering data. So, how can i determine whether the usercount, questioncount distribution follows a power law. When used with a binary response variable, this model is known as a linear probability model and can be used as a way to describe conditional probabilities. However, at times the techniques used to t the power law distribution have been inappropriate. Excel trendline power law solutions experts exchange.
Click here if youre looking to post or find an r datascience job. As you can see in the reproducible example below, one of the outputs of this function is the loglikelihood loglik of the fitted parameters. Package powerlaw the comprehensive r archive network. Many r packages are supported in the power bi service and more are being supported all the time, and some packages are not. On the negative side, power package cant live on your golf club wont fit in the bag, and its too big and awkwardly shaped to live in your golf bag. You can compare a power law to this distribution in the normal way shown above r, p results. Allometric scaling laws for relationships between biological variables are among the best known power law functions in nature. The power is computed separately for each gene, with an optional correction to the significance level for multiple comparison. There is a misunderstanding that we can use these packages in power bi desktop r visual.
The powerlaw package aims to make fitting power laws and other heavytailed distributions straightforward. Query and download from the nexus network repository. This package implements both the discrete and continuous maximum likelihood estimators for fitting the power law distribution to data. Measurement and implications prepared by julian di giovanni, andrei a. Before transforming data, see the steps to handle violations of assumption section in the assessing model assumptions chapter. Appoint a trusted person to control your legal and financial affairs on your behalf. Fitting a powerlaw distribution function to discrete data.
Added option to fit the parameters when data are added to the tool. In the last few years, the number of packages has grown exponentially this is a short post giving steps on how to actually install r packages. I have been trying to fit a power law function through a data set through. Power law data analysis university of california, berkeley.
Functions for the computation of power and level tables for hypothesis tests, in latex format, functions to build explanatory graphs for studying power of test statistics. The pow function computes power for each element of a gene expression experiment using an vector of estimated standard deviations. How to test whether a distribution follows a power law. The power package can help any golfer learn to set the club properly and produces a pure, powerful, repeatable swing. By scott chamberlain this article was first published on recology, and kindly contributed to r bloggers. Rpusvm is a standalone terminal tool for svm training and prediction with gpus. To install an r package, open an r session and type at the command line. R packages are collections of functions and data sets developed by the community. Aicloudhow to use aicloud app on your phone to send files to router.
1198 800 913 1186 367 410 308 1163 597 1063 261 485 1502 342 240 1165 175 737 873 1627 246 737 902 1079 942 1235 1157 110 1315 1172 518 1391 1086 1155 1425 799 539 797 1276 307 1009 725 439 1451 1194